The Cannabis Behind a Good Mood: Terpenes for Euphoria

close up of a woman smoking a blunt and smiling

Some smoke sessions are better for your mood than others. Typically your get what you bring into an experience with cannabis, but some strains help make things lighter, more social, and bring the giggles (the scientific term). 

If you’ve noticed that certain products reliably put you there and others don’t, even at the same THC percentage, terpenes are a big part of the explanation. 

 

Here’s what to look for when you’re shopping for cannabis products to help you feel euphoric. 

4 Terpenes for Euphoria 

Limonene 

The most recognizable of the mood-forward terpenes. Found naturally in citrus rinds, limonene shows up consistently in products people describe as uplifting, energetic, and social. It interacts with serotonin and dopamine pathways, and anecdotally it’s the one most associated with that bright, everything-is-funnier feeling. Terpinolene 

 Less common, but worth knowing. Terpinolene has a more complex scent — floral, slightly piney, a little herbal — and tends to appear in strains associated with cerebral, creative, or energetic effects. Ocimene 

The underrated one. Sweet, slightly tropical, and easy to overlook on a label — but ocimene tends to show up in strains with light, euphoric effects. Linalool (in the right context)

More commonly associated with relaxation, but in smaller amounts alongside limonene or terpinolene, linalool can contribute a smooth, easy euphoria without pulling the experience toward sleepy. It’s the difference between unwinding and shutting down — worth noting when it appears lower in a profile rather than at the top.
